Abstract
A mobile robot includes a chassis, a shell moveably mounted on the chassis, and a cutting assembly mounted to the chassis. The mobile robot also includes a communication system that includes an antenna module disposed on a rear portion of the mobile robot. The antenna module includes a base assembly, and an antenna assembly mounted to the base assembly by a spring. The antenna assembly includes a ranging antenna, and at least three angle antennas arranged axisymmetrically about the ranging antenna, such that the ranging antenna and the three angle antennas define a tetrahedral geometry for determining an angle of arrival for one or more incident signals.
